    Anyone have a Lakewood bow case ?

    I was looking for some reviews. They look like what I've been wanting. Hoping someone here has one & can give an overall review. Thanks

    #2
    I love mine. It works great and you can keep the quiver on. Only took it on a plane once but it did great. Had no issues. I just packed a towel into the extra space for some extra cushion but that was probably unnecessary. Would definitely recommend if you find a good deal on one

    Comment


      #3
      My daughter uses one and it's really nice and sturdy. It's about 3 years old and is as good as it was when new. Very well made with a heavy duty zipper. She's got the wide stand up model with the arrow case and an accessory box.

            If you're talking about the Bowfile, I absolutely love mine, Was worried about how it would hold up but I have had it for 3-4 years now and it still looks brand new. Also flew to Hawaii with mine and it did great. Almost wish I would have gone and gotten the double bowfile so I could carry my bow and backup bow. It is so convenient with the accessory case and being able to put my bow with the quiver still on and not having to strap it in or anything. Highly suggest

                Is it waterproof or how does the dust affect the zippers? I keep my bow in the bed of the Ranger while heading out and it's exposed to dust and moisture if raining.

                  Definitely not waterproof. Some of the interior supports in my brother's are masonite. I feel like I read that they changed to a different material though.

                  I like how it holds the bow with the quiver on, I hate that it won't stay standing up in the back of the truck unless you wedge it against something
